In the last year 41 people have experienced cancer reoccurrences, with 10 instances of secondary cancers recorded
A reoccurrence is when someone who has previously battled the illness receives a further diagnosis, a secondary case is when the cancer spreads to another part of the body.
The revelation came following a question asked by MHK for Arbory, Castletown and Malew Jason Moorhouse in the House of Keys last Tuesday.
Health and Social Care Minister Lawrie Hooper gave the answer, and outlined what support is available for those people
